Meyers Clovis Ackerman, 88, died Friday, April 17, 2015, with family present at Munson Hospice House.

Meyers was preceded in death by his beloved wife of 56 years, Harriet Agnes Ackerman, his mother, Alice Irene Walker, his father, Meyers C. Ackerman Sr., his brother, Daniel F. Kelley and Daniel's son, Patrick Kelley, his sister, Maxine C. Miller, brother-in-law, Dale Miller, son-in-law, Lawrence P. Johnson and his Aunt and Uncle, Otis and Mary Mead.

He is survived by his daughters, Melanie Ackerman (William Stebner) and Roberta A. Walker, his sister-in-law, Vivian Kelley, several nieces and nephews and great-nieces and nephews.

Meyers was born January 23, 1927. He grew up in the small, farm town of Mt. Vernon, Ohio, where he loved spending summers and working in the fields of his Aunt Mary and Uncle Otis' nearby farm. He also lived in Cleveland and Columbus, Ohio.

He honorably served in the U.S. Navy (CBMU #630) Sea Bees, stationed on the island of Okinawa during WWII. To support a family, Meyers began a career in the Weighing Industry. Meyers successfully continued in this field as a salesman, sales manager and design engineer until his retirement.

In Columbus, Ohio Meyers met his life-long love, Harriet Streamer. They married December 22, 1950. They lived and raised their family in Columbus and Grand Rapids, and then continued further north to Traverse City.

Together, they enjoyed a lifetime of family gatherings and many celebrations. Rarely idle, Meyers and Harriet shared and enjoyed many hobbies and interests, and now, after a brief pause, resume that togetherness.

Meyers, sharing his love of life with many, in return is loved by many. With a kind, genuine heart,
a spirit light with laughter, an ever present smile and witty humor he cheered and comforted us all.
